The role and function of vitamin B12

1. Prevent anemia

After being absorbed by the human body, vitamin B12 can promote the development and maturation of red blood cells in the human blood, and improve the human hematopoietic function. It can maintain the normal and stable state of the human hematopoietic function, and prevent the occurrence of pernicious anemia. Those who already have anemia can supplement with an appropriate amount of vitamin B12 in time, which can also gradually alleviate the symptoms of anemia.

3. Maintain stable neurological function

Vitamin B12 also has a very positive effect on the human nervous system. It is important for maintaining the health of the human nervous system and can directly participate in the synthesis of lipoproteins in human nerve tissue. If the human body cannot absorb enough vitamin B12, it will lead to depression and neurasthenia, and sometimes cause people to have various adverse symptoms such as palpitations, forgetfulness and anxiety, which are very detrimental to human health.
